Managing Your Bankroll for Serious Bettors
For serious bettors who aim to maintain their profits over the long haul, proper bankroll management is critical. It's not about how much you have, but how wisely you allocate it. A well-crafted bankroll plan allows you to minimize risk and boost your chances of reaching consistent success. Start by determining a dedicated betting budget, a sum of money you're comfortable committing without jeopardizing your security.
Determine a staking plan that corresponds to your bankroll size and risk tolerance. This involves selecting the percentage of your bankroll you're willing to wager on each bet. Remember that consistent, strategic betting is superior than chasing big wins.
- Record your bets and their outcomes to gain a clear understanding of your performance. This data can invaluable in refining your strategy and tweaking your bankroll management plan as needed.
- Refrain from chasing losses by increasing your bets in an attempt to recover for previous losses. This can quickly lead to a downward spiral
Keep in mind that bankroll management is an ongoing process. Adapt and willing to modify your plan as you gain experience and learn more about your betting style. By treating your bankroll with the dignity it deserves, you can set yourself up for long-term success in the world of sports betting.

First and foremost, research the sports you're interested in betting on. Become familiar with the guidelines, key players, team weaknesses, and recent results. This knowledge will empower you to make informed bets.
Next, familiarize yourself with the different types of sports gambles available. There are various options, such as point spreads, moneylines, over/unders, and parlays, each with its own set of rules and risks.
Analyze check here reputable sports betting platforms and compare their odds, bonuses, and customer service offerings. Choose a platform that suits your needs and provides a secure and reliable environment for placing your bets.
Finally, remember to gamble responsibly. Set a budget, stick to it, and never chase losses. Sports betting should be an enjoyable activity, not a source of financial stress.
